Seow Chuan Koh is a Singaporean philatelist who was added to the Roll of Distinguished Philatelists in 1992.[1]

Koh has formed gold medal winning collections of classic India, Jaipur State, Perak, and Japanese handstamps on the stamps of the Straits Settlements.
